Proper Lifting Techniques with Hoist Beams

Employing overhead beams safely requires thorough planning and adherence to standard guidelines. Always verify the beam’s integrity before each lift, checking for damage . Ensure the cargo is properly balanced on the girder and that the hoisting machinery , such as the device, has an adequate limit for the aggregate burden. Never go beyond the beam's maximum capacity, and remember to account for the inclination of the lift , as this will affect the strains on the girder . Adhere to supplier's instructions and regional standards.

A Comprehensive Guide to Spreader Beam Uses

Spreader girders are vital lifting apparatuses used in numerous industries , particularly where heavy loads need to be shifted. Their main function is to share the burden across various lifting areas, safely reducing stress on separate hooks . Common uses include raising pre-fabricated components, oversized machinery, and wind components . Proper determination of the appropriate spreader girder layout and secure operating procedures are crucial for avoiding mishaps and guaranteeing a successful lifting operation .
